Why Shakes Work Well With Mounjaro

Mounjaro slows digestion, reduces appetite and helps regulate blood sugar levels. These effects are beneficial for weight loss, but they also mean that some patients find large meals uncomfortable. Shakes can offer a gentler option because they are easy to digest, can be consumed slowly and allow you to control portion sizes.

Shakes are helpful because they can:

    • Reduce nausea by avoiding heavy meals
    • Provide steady energy without overwhelming the stomach
    • Support protein intake, which helps maintain muscle
    • Offer hydration while delivering nutrients
    • Be prepared quickly when appetite is low

The Best Shake To Drink To Lose Weight On Mounjaro

Although everyone responds differently to Mounjaro, several types of shakes tend to work well for most people. Focus on blends that are gentle, low in sugar, high in protein and easy to digest.

Best shake to drink to lose weight on Mounjaro

Some of the most effective options include:

1. High Protein, Low Sugar Whey or Plant Based Shakes

Protein helps stabilise blood sugar, reduces hunger and preserves muscle mass. Choose shakes with around 20 to 30 grams of protein and minimal added sugar.

Good options include:

    • Whey isolate shakes for quick digestion
    • Pea protein shakes for plant-based needs
    • Brown rice blends for sensitive stomachs

2. Nausea-Friendly Smoothies

For patients who experience early-stage nausea, gentle smoothies can feel more manageable than heavier meals. Aim for simple ingredients that are soft on the stomach.

Nausea-friendly blends include:

    • Banana with oat milk and pea protein
    • Mango with lactose-free yoghurt
    • Blueberries with almond milk and a tablespoon of oats

3. Electrolyte Supported Shakes

Some people find they drink less while on Mounjaro due to appetite changes. Including electrolytes in your shakes can help maintain hydration.

Useful additions include:

    • A small pinch of salt
    • Coconut water
    • A low-sugar electrolyte powder

These ingredients boost hydration without adding unnecessary calories.

4. Fibre Friendly Shakes

Mounjaro can slow digestion slightly, so including a little fibre can help maintain regularity. Start very small and increase gradually to avoid discomfort.

Possible fibre additions include:

    • Chia seeds
    • Oats
    • Ground flaxseed

Portion Size Matters

Because Mounjaro slows digestion, large shakes can feel too filling. Smaller, more frequent shakes often work better.

General recommendations include:

    • Start with half-size shakes
    • Sip slowly rather than drinking quickly
    • Avoid adding too many ingredients
    • Keep blends simple during nausea-prone weeks

When To Drink Shakes During Your Weekly Cycle

Some patients prefer shakes on injection day or the following morning. Others find shakes most useful during the first two days after an increased dose. Listening to your body is the key to finding the right timing.

Common patterns include:

    • A protein shake for breakfast when appetite is low
    • A gentle smoothie after your weekly dose
    • A hydration-focused shake during nausea spells
    • A high-protein shake after light exercise

What To Avoid In Shakes While Using Mounjaro

Certain ingredients can worsen nausea or slow digestion even further. Avoiding heavy or high-fat additions can make your shakes much more comfortable.

Try to stay away from:

    • Large amounts of nut butter
    • Full-fat dairy
    • Very sweet fruit juice
    • Excessive artificial sweeteners
    • Thick shakes with too many ingredients
